Town adds EV charging to Ponquogue Beach

Electric vehicle owners can recharge on the East End thanks to two new EV charging stations at Ponquogue Beach in Hampton Bays.

The Type 1 chargers are located in the parking lot next to the newly renovated Ponquogue Beach Pavilion and can support up to four vehicles at a time.

The stations are operated by El Segundo, Calif.-based EV Connect, which won a $4 million contract with the New York Power Authority in 2016 to build 300 vehicle charging stations throughout the state. Users will have to download the company’s EV Connect app and pay an electric use fee in order to charge a vehicle.

Town of Southampton beach parking permits are required to access the areas, which are open daily from 9 a.m. to 9 p.m. through Labor Day.
